A bank in North Babylon was robbed Tuesday morning, Suffolk County police said.

A man demanded money from a teller at Capital One, at 1383 Deer Park Ave., at 11:45 a.m., then ran with the money northward through a parking lot, police said.

The suspect appeared to be 40 to 45 years old, about 5 feet 6 inches tall with a medium build, police said. He wore shorts and a dark-colored T-shirt, police said.

Detectives are asking anyone with information call Crime Stoppers at 1-800-220-TIPS.
